Nothing in the whole world felt better than Owen’s arms. In the early morning moonlight, I lay with my head on his chest, my arms around his waist, and his arms wrapped around my back. He was so big, strong, and protective I never wanted to be apart from him. And I knew in my heart like I knew the sun would rise that morning, he would forgive me for what my mother planned to do to him.
No—he wouldn’t forgive me. He’d never hold it against me to begin with. Just like I could never hold him accountable for what his father and grandfather had done before him. We were different from the people who brought us into the world. Better.
Owen wasn’t just tall, smart, and handsome—he had a soul, and that was a million times more important to me. I’d spent my whole life watching ruthless people destroy each other like pigs fighting in the mud. More than once, I’d been a captive audience, an innocent bystander struck by the filth of the endless feeding frenzy. I’d never been able to protect myself, and maybe I still couldn’t, but I could protect him.
To do that, to spare Owen the pain I’d known, I had to be sharp, strong, and act alone. As I lay there, enjoying the warmth of the only loving embrace I’d ever known, I knew I had to act before I changed my mind. Tilting my head back, I kissed the line of his handsome jaw and slowly rolled away from him...

The book had all the elements for a intriguing romantic suspense, but failed miserably. It’s start out with a bang. At first it caught my interest,but it didn’t hold it. By Chapter 13, I just couldn’t read on, as the storyline wasn’t capturing my attention. Though, I few hours later I did skip to read the last chapter and epilogue, which leaves the readers wondering. I wasn’t buying Heather and Owen’s instant lust and was turned off by them immediately having sex - gross they hadn’t even showered before their romp. I can only imagine how gross their bodies would have been after their earlier life threatening incident at sea. Plus, no mention of birth control, which is just irresponsible between two strangers. The storyline with was too political and ruthless. The scene with the Coast Guard was unbelievable and disrespectful to this upstanding military organization.
Heather Carrington is being taken to a facility that shouldn’t exist, but then, neither should she. The daughter of an affair between her mother and her mother’s boss, a senator, Heather has been the exact opposite of her parent’s for as long as she can remember. But the arrest for protesting in Colorado was the final straw for them. Now she’s on a boat heading for a facility on an island that’s supposedly been shut down for years. When there’s drama aboard the boat, and that drama ends with the boat ending up on with a hole and stuck on the rocks near Whisper Cove, Heather’s able to get off, just before the explosion rocks the area. Owen Kelly, mayoral candidate, is out for his daily jog when he happens to see a woman in a lifeboat struggling. Swimming out to meet her, he pulls the boat to safely. Taking her in and getting her to the sheriff, Logan Fox, to report what happened. But Owen is just more than a mayoral candidate, he’s also the town lawyer, and reno guy. Currently working and staying at a friend’s Victorian house in town while he completely redoes it, he takes Heather there until they can figure out how to help her. But Heather can help Owen more than he can help her, it turns out that the man running against him was placed there by her father’s company so that they can take over the town. Yes, a big, bad, evil corporation wants to take over the town and will do anything, including arson, theft, etc. to get it. Will Heather and Owen be able to stop them from taking over the town? Will Owen get elected? Can Owen protect Heather from her well connected family bent on putting her away so their secrets aren’t exposed? You have to read this story to find out!! I truly enjoyed this story, it’s well written, with wonderful characters (my favorite was Mrs. Tuttle). You don’t have to read the books in order, but why wouldn’t you?
